Receive customized Indian massage therapy designed for your preferences

Personalization begins with a short conversation. You can discuss daily energy levels, areas of general tightness, and the pressure range you prefer. Many Indian-inspired sessions use sesame or coconut oil, sometimes infused with herbs. If you prefer lighter texture, fractionated coconut or grapeseed oil may be suggested. A practitioner can focus on areas such as neck and shoulders from desk work, lower back from prolonged standing, or feet and calves when you seek grounding.

Common variations can also be adapted. A full-body warm oil routine offers steady, rhythmic strokes for overall relaxation. Scalp-focused work can provide a soothing, meditative quality, while a dedicated foot sequence may feel especially calming at the end of the day. If you are pregnant or have health considerations, it is important to work only with professionals trained for those needs and to confirm what is appropriate beforehand.

Preparation for a home visit is straightforward. Clear a space about the size of a yoga mat plus room to walk around it, and set aside two clean towels you do not mind using with oil. Have water available and silence phone notifications. Light, breathable clothing is useful before and after the session. Plan a quiet window of time afterward, allowing the settling effects to continue without rushing back into tasks.

Safety and professionalism matter. In the United States, licensing and scope of practice rules vary by state, so verifying credentials is standard. Practitioners maintain boundaries, obtain consent, and explain what to expect. You can ask about the oil used, how linens are handled, and how your privacy will be protected. If you have allergies, recent injuries, or skin conditions, share these details so the session can be adjusted. Good communication helps shape a session that feels respectful, calming, and well-aligned with your goals.
